Risk Assessment Checklist for Storing Decades of Paper Charts in an Offsite Warehouse
Use this risk assessment checklist to evaluate whether your offsite warehouse can preserve decades of paper charts safely and compliantly. Each section outlines what to verify, target thresholds, and the documentation you should maintain to demonstrate control.
Environmental Conditions
Targets and tolerances
- Temperature Regulation: maintain 60–70°F (16–21°C) with daily swings no greater than ±2°F and weekly swings under ±5°F.
- Relative Humidity Control: keep 30–50% RH with daily variation within ±5%. Avoid dew point conditions that could cause condensation.
- Stability over perfection: steady conditions are safer than frequent cycling around an ideal target.
Monitoring and documentation
- Deploy calibrated data loggers at multiple heights and zones; review trends weekly and after weather events.
- Set text/email alarms for out-of-range readings; investigate root causes and document corrective actions.
- Calibrate sensors at least annually; retain calibration certificates and change-control records.
Air quality, light, and moisture exclusion
- Use MERV-13 (or better) filtration; keep dust levels low through scheduled housekeeping.
- Limit light exposure; fit UV-filtered fixtures and switch lights off when aisles are unoccupied.
- Prevent water intrusion: inspect roofs and plumbing, test floor drains/sumps, and maintain clear condensate lines.
- Store cartons at least 4–6 inches off the floor; avoid locations under pipes or against exterior walls.
Security Measures
Physical and electronic controls
- Perimeter protections: exterior lighting, secured entrances, and 24/7 CCTV with retention policies aligned to risk.
- Access Control Logs: badge every entry/exit to storage zones; review and reconcile logs monthly.
- Two-factor access for vaults or high-value collections; visitor escorts and temporary badges with time limits.
Process integrity and chain of custody
- Intake and retrieval: verify identities, document purpose, and record item movements with barcodes.
- Background checks for staff handling records; confidentiality agreements and role-based permissions.
- Incident response: define escalation paths for lost items, intrusion alarms, or environmental excursions.
Shelving and Organization
Shelving specifications
- Use powder-coated steel shelving or map cabinets; avoid bare wood that can off-gas acids.
- Anchor units, add anti-tip and seismic bracing where applicable; verify load ratings exceed expected weights.
- Maintain 18 inches of clearance below sprinklers and keep aisles clear for egress and inspection.
- For mobile compaction systems: verify emergency stops, fire aisles, and even loading across carriages.
Organization and retrieval
- Adopt a logical location code (aisle–bay–shelf–position) and barcode every container and item group.
- Separate formats and sizes: flat-file cabinets for oversized charts; sturdy tubes or folders for rolled items.
- Document a misfile recovery process; track pick accuracy and retrieval time as performance indicators.
Handling and ergonomics
- Provide step-stools, carts with brakes, and lifting aids; train staff in safe handling to avoid creasing or tears.
- Set maximum stack heights for cartons to prevent crushing and make top boxes reachable without strain.
Packaging Materials
Material standards and selection
- Use Acid-Free Packaging: lignin-free, alkaline-buffered folders and boxes for most paper; choose unbuffered for sensitive media (e.g., some coated or color materials).
- Prefer inert plastics (polyester, polypropylene, polyethylene) for sleeves and supports; avoid PVC.
- Specify board strength appropriate to weight; choose water-based, pH-neutral adhesives and labels.
Preparation and labeling
- Remove damaging fasteners; replace with stainless-steel paper clips or archival alternatives.
- Flatten gently; if necessary, use controlled humidification performed by a conservator—never force folds.
- Label with pencil on folders or with archival labels on boxes; apply barcodes to standard locations.
Quality assurance
- Spot-check each lot against certificates of conformity; record vendor, lot number, and date received.
- Establish a sampling plan to detect adhesive failures, off-gassing, or brittleness over time.
Fire Safety
Detection and suppression
- Install early warning smoke detection (e.g., aspirating systems) integrated with monitored alarms.
- Use pre-action or double-interlock sprinklers in storage areas to reduce accidental discharge risk.
- For high-value vaults, consider clean-agent Fire Suppression Systems; verify agent compatibility with paper and packaging.
Compartmentation and prevention
- Maintain fire-rated separations and self-closing fire doors; seal penetrations and cable passthroughs.
- Control ignition sources: no smoking, hot-work permits, and periodic thermal imaging of electrical panels.
- Housekeeping: keep aisles clear, remove combustibles from mechanical rooms, and manage waste daily.
Inspection, testing, and readiness
- Document monthly visual checks and scheduled inspections for detectors, alarms, extinguishers, and valves.
- Keep 18-inch sprinkler clearance, verify valve tamper seals, and test notification paths at defined intervals.
- Stage salvage supplies (absorbents, plastic sheeting, boxes) to accelerate post-incident response.
Pest Control
Pest Management Protocols
- Adopt integrated monitoring with non-toxic sticky traps; map trap locations and log counts monthly.
- Seal building envelopes, install door sweeps, and eliminate food sources; clean on a set schedule.
- Inspect inbound shipments; quarantine suspect materials away from collections until cleared.
Response and remediation
- Identify species, isolate affected items, and treat with freezing (e.g., −18°C/0°F for 72 hours, repeat if needed) or anoxic methods.
- Record incidents, treatments, and outcomes; trend data to spot seasonal patterns and structural gaps.
Emergency Planning
Emergency Response Planning
- Conduct a site-specific risk assessment for floods, storms, fire, earthquakes, and utility failures.
- Define roles, a call-down list, salvage priorities, and decision thresholds for relocation.
- Pre-arrange vendors for freeze-drying, transport, generators, and dehumidification; test contact numbers quarterly.
Continuity and resilience
- Protect indexes and finding aids with offsite or cloud backups; maintain backup power for HVAC and alarms.
- Stage emergency kits: PPE, tools, tarps, absorbents, fans, and documentation forms.
- Document post-event workflows, including triage categories (dry, damp, wet, contaminated) and chain-of-custody.
Training, drills, and assurance
- Run at least annual drills for evacuation and water ingress; conduct after-action reviews and update plans.
- Audit readiness with checklists, photos, and corrective actions tracked to closure.

What environmental conditions are optimal for storing paper charts?
Aim for Temperature Regulation at 60–70°F (16–21°C) and Relative Humidity Control at 30–50% RH, with minimal daily and weekly fluctuations. Keep light exposure low, filter air effectively, and prevent water intrusion. Stability matters as much as the setpoints.
How can fire risks be minimized in offsite storage?
Combine early detection with appropriate Fire Suppression Systems (pre-action sprinklers or clean agents in vaults), maintain fire-rated separations, control ignition sources, and keep aisles clear. Test alarms and valves on schedule, train staff, and stage salvage supplies for rapid response.
What security measures protect stored paper records?
Use layered controls: perimeter lighting and cameras, badged entry to storage zones with reviewed Access Control Logs, two-factor access for vaults, visitor escorts, background-checked staff, and documented chain-of-custody for every movement. Define incident escalation and conduct regular audits.
How often should storage audits be conducted?
Perform daily walk-throughs for leaks and obstructions, weekly reviews of environmental trends, monthly checks of Access Control Logs and pest monitors, quarterly calibration/maintenance verifications, and an annual full risk assessment with fire and emergency drills. Trigger immediate audits after any incident or severe weather event.
